A common contractor (GC) acts as a manager for big tasks. They hire contractors, generally known as subcontractors, to carry out specialized tasks such as putting in new plumbing, installing new counter tops, or rewiring a house. General contractors ensure that all permits are filed, all deadlines are met, and prices keep on price range.
